Transaction 7624873f1aa5f73d5aebd1393ee6af950fb7823744f109f0a19db14a2cf30492

50 Input
1 Outputs
  • 7624873f1aa5f73d5aebd1393ee6af950fb7823744f109f0a19db14a2cf30492:0
  • value  48360210
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P